Attributes
Extremely Popular
Repository
Current version released
4 years ago
Versions
- 4.17.19Latest
- 4.17.16
- 4.17.15
- 4.17.15-npm
- 4.17.15-es
- 4.17.15-amd
- 4.17.14
- 4.17.14-npm
- 4.17.14-es
- 4.17.14-amd
- 4.17.13
- 4.17.13-npm
- 4.17.13-es
- 4.17.13-amd
- 4.17.12
- 4.17.12-npm
- 4.17.12-es
- 4.17.12-amd
- 4.17.11
- 4.17.11-npm
- 4.17.11-es
- 4.17.11-amd
- 4.17.10
- 4.17.10-npm
- 4.17.10-es
- 4.17.10-amd
- 4.17.9
- 4.17.9-npm
- 4.17.9-es
- 4.17.9-amd
- 4.17.8-es
- 4.17.7-es
- 4.17.6-es
- 4.17.5
- 4.17.5-npm
- 4.17.5-es
- 4.17.5-amd
- 4.17.4
- 4.17.4-npm
- 4.17.4-es
- 4.17.4-amd
- 4.17.3
- 4.17.3-npm
- 4.17.3-es
- 4.17.3-amd
- 4.17.2
- 4.17.2-npm
- 4.17.2-es
- 4.17.2-amd
- 4.17.1
- 4.17.1-npm
- 4.17.1-es
- 4.17.1-amd
- 4.17.0
- 4.17.0-npm
- 4.17.0-es
- 4.17.0-amd
- 4.16.6
- 4.16.6-npm
- 4.16.6-es
- 4.16.6-amd
- 4.16.5
- 4.16.5-npm
- 4.16.5-es
- 4.16.5-amd
- 4.16.4
- 4.16.4-npm
- 4.16.4-es
- 4.16.4-amd
- 4.16.3
- 4.16.3-npm
- 4.16.3-es
- 4.16.3-amd
- 4.16.2
- 4.16.2-npm
- 4.16.2-es
- 4.16.2-amd
- 4.16.1
- 4.16.1-npm
- 4.16.1-es
- 4.16.1-amd
- 4.16.0
- 4.16.0-npm
- 4.16.0-es
- 4.16.0-amd
- 4.15.0
- 4.15.0-npm
- 4.15.0-npm-packages
- 4.15.0-es
- 4.15.0-amd
- 4.14.2
- 4.14.2-npm
- 4.14.2-es
- 4.14.2-amd
- 4.14.1
- 4.14.1-npm
- 4.14.1-es
- 4.14.1-amd
- 4.14.0
- 4.14.0-npm
lodash v4.16.0
Site | Docs | FP Guide | Contributing | Wiki | Code of Conduct | Twitter | Chat
The Lodash library exported as a UMD module.
Generated using lodash-cli:
$ npm run build
$ lodash -o ./dist/lodash.js
$ lodash core -o ./dist/lodash.core.js
Download
Lodash is released under the MIT license & supports modern environments.
Review the build differences & pick one that’s right for you.
Installation
In a browser:
<script src="lodash.js"></script>
Using npm:
$ npm i -g npm
$ npm i --save lodash
In Node.js:
// Load the full build.
var _ = require('lodash');
// Load the core build.
var _ = require('lodash/core');
// Load the FP build for immutable auto-curried iteratee-first data-last methods.
var fp = require('lodash/fp');
// Load method categories.
var array = require('lodash/array');
var object = require('lodash/fp/object');
// Cherry-pick methods for smaller browserify/rollup/webpack bundles.
var chunk = require('lodash/chunk');
var extend = require('lodash/fp/extend');
Note:
Install n_ for Lodash use in the Node.js < 6 REPL.
Why Lodash?
Lodash makes JavaScript easier by taking the hassle out of working with arrays,
numbers, objects, strings, etc. Lodash’s modular methods are great for:
- Iterating arrays, objects, & strings
- Manipulating & testing values
- Creating composite functions
Module Formats
Lodash is available in a variety of builds & module formats.